“What episode centers on a silicon-based lifeform killing miners on Janus VI?” The answer is “The Devil in the Dark.” The episode first aired on March 9, 1967, during the first season of Star Trek: The Original Series.
The Enterprise responds to an emergency at a pergium-mining colony on Janus VI, where an unknown creature has killed workers and damaged equipment with a corrosive substance. Kirk initially treats the creature as a dangerous monster, while Spock suspects that it may represent an entirely unfamiliar form of life.
The investigation reveals the Horta, a silicon-based organism that tunnels through rock and protects thousands of silicon nodules—its species’ eggs. Spock’s mind meld establishes that the Horta attacked because miners had destroyed its offspring. McCoy then saves the wounded creature with silicon-based cement, transforming the crisis into a first-contact story.
The common mix-up is “The Man Trap,” which also features a creature killing humans, but its salt-draining alien is unrelated to Janus VI or silicon-based life.
